# Website
This website is built using [Docusaurus](https://docusaurus.io/), a modern static website generator.
### Installation
```
$ yarn
```
### Local Development
```
$ yarn start
```
This command starts a local development server and opens up a browser window. Most changes are reflected live without having to restart the server.
### Build
```
$ yarn build
```
This command generates static content into the `build` directory and can be served using any static contents hosting service.
### Deployment
Using SSH:
```
$ USE_SSH=true yarn deploy
```
Not using SSH:
```
$ GIT_USER=<Your GitHub username> yarn deploy
```
If you are using GitHub pages for hosting, this command is a convenient way to build the website and push to the `gh-pages` branch.

# Architecture Overview
Reflector is built as a modern, scalable, microservices-based application designed to handle audio processing workloads efficiently while maintaining data privacy and control.
## System Components
### Frontend Application
The user interface is built with **Next.js 14** using the App Router pattern, providing:
- Server-side rendering for optimal performance
- Real-time WebSocket connections for live transcription
- WebRTC support for audio streaming
- Responsive design with Chakra UI components
### Backend API Server
The core API is powered by **FastAPI**, a modern Python framework that provides:
- High-performance async request handling
- Automatic OpenAPI documentation generation
- Type safety with Pydantic models
- WebSocket support for real-time updates
### Processing Pipeline
Audio processing is handled through a modular pipeline architecture:
```
Audio Input → Chunking → Transcription → Diarization → Post-Processing → Storage
```
Each step can run independently and in parallel, allowing for:
- Scalable processing of large files
- Real-time streaming capabilities
- Fault tolerance and retry mechanisms
### Worker Architecture
Background tasks are managed by **Celery** workers with **Redis** as the message broker:
- Distributed task processing
- Priority queues for time-sensitive operations
- Automatic retry on failure
- Progress tracking and notifications
### GPU Acceleration
ML models run on GPU-accelerated infrastructure:
- **Modal.com** for serverless GPU processing
- Support for local GPU deployment (coming soon)
- Automatic scaling based on demand
- Cost-effective pay-per-use model
## Data Flow
### File Processing Flow
1. **Upload**: User uploads audio file through web interface
2. **Storage**: File stored temporarily or in S3
3. **Queue**: Processing job added to Celery queue
4. **Chunking**: Audio split into 30-second segments
5. **Parallel Processing**: Chunks processed simultaneously
6. **Assembly**: Results merged and aligned
7. **Post-Processing**: Summary, topics, translation
8. **Delivery**: Results stored and user notified
### Live Streaming Flow
1. **WebRTC Connection**: Browser establishes peer connection
2. **Audio Capture**: Microphone audio streamed to server
3. **Buffering**: Audio buffered for processing
4. **VAD**: Voice activity detection segments speech
5. **Real-time Processing**: Segments transcribed immediately
6. **WebSocket Updates**: Results streamed back to client
7. **Continuous Assembly**: Full transcript built progressively
## Deployment Architecture
### Container-Based Deployment
All components are containerized for consistent deployment:
```yaml
services:
frontend: # Next.js application
backend: # FastAPI server
worker: # Celery workers
redis: # Message broker
postgres: # Database
caddy: # Reverse proxy
```
### Networking
- **Host Network Mode**: Required for WebRTC/ICE compatibility
- **Caddy Reverse Proxy**: Handles SSL termination and routing
- **WebSocket Upgrade**: Supports real-time connections
## Scalability Considerations
### Horizontal Scaling
- **Stateless Backend**: Multiple API server instances
- **Worker Pools**: Add workers based on queue depth
- **Database Pooling**: Connection management for concurrent access
### Vertical Scaling
- **GPU Workers**: Scale up for faster model inference
- **Memory Optimization**: Efficient audio buffering
- **CPU Optimization**: Multi-threaded processing where applicable
## Security Architecture
### Authentication & Authorization
- **JWT Tokens**: Stateless authentication
- **Authentik Integration**: Enterprise SSO support
- **Role-Based Access**: Granular permissions
### Data Protection
- **Encryption at Rest**: Database and S3 encryption
- **Encryption in Transit**: TLS for all connections
- **Temporary Storage**: Automatic cleanup of processed files
### Privacy by Design
- **Local Processing**: Option to process entirely on-premises
- **No Training on User Data**: Models are pre-trained
- **Data Isolation**: Multi-tenant data separation
## Integration Points
### External Services
- **Modal.com**: GPU processing
- **AWS S3**: Long-term storage
- **Whereby**: Video conferencing rooms
- **Zulip**: Chat integration (optional)
### APIs and Webhooks
- **RESTful API**: Standard CRUD operations
- **WebSocket API**: Real-time updates
- **Webhook Notifications**: Processing completion events
- **OpenAPI Specification**: Machine-readable API definition
## Performance Optimization
### Caching Strategy
- **Redis Cache**: Frequently accessed data
- **CDN**: Static asset delivery
- **Browser Cache**: Client-side optimization
### Database Optimization
- **Indexed Queries**: Fast search and retrieval
- **Connection Pooling**: Efficient resource usage
- **Query Optimization**: N+1 query prevention
### Processing Optimization
- **Batch Processing**: Efficient GPU utilization
- **Parallel Execution**: Multi-core CPU usage
- **Stream Processing**: Reduced memory footprint
## Monitoring and Observability
### Metrics Collection
- **Application Metrics**: Request rates, response times
- **System Metrics**: CPU, memory, disk usage
- **Business Metrics**: Transcription accuracy, processing times
### Logging
- **Structured Logging**: JSON format for analysis
- **Log Aggregation**: Centralized log management
- **Error Tracking**: Sentry integration
### Health Checks
- **Liveness Probes**: Component availability
- **Readiness Probes**: Service readiness
- **Dependency Checks**: External service status

# Welcome to Reflector
Reflector is a privacy-focused, self-hosted AI-powered audio transcription and meeting analysis platform that provides real-time transcription, speaker diarization, translation, and summarization for audio content and live meetings. With complete control over your data and infrastructure, you can run models on your own hardware (roadmap - currently supports Modal.com for GPU processing).
## What is Reflector?
Reflector is a web application that utilizes AI to process audio content, providing:
- **Real-time Transcription**: Convert speech to text using [Whisper](https://github.com/openai/whisper) (multi-language) or [Parakeet](https://github.com/NVIDIA/NeMo) (English) models
- **Speaker Diarization**: Identify and label different speakers using [Pyannote](https://github.com/pyannote/pyannote-audio) 3.1
- **Live Translation**: Translate audio content in real-time to 100+ languages with [Facebook Seamless-M4T](https://github.com/facebookresearch/seamless_communication)
- **Topic Detection & Summarization**: Extract key topics and generate concise summaries using LLMs
- **Meeting Recording**: Create permanent records of meetings with searchable transcripts
## Features
| Feature | Public Mode | Private Mode |
|---------|------------|--------------|
| **Authentication** | None required | Required |
| **Audio Upload** | ✅ | ✅ |
| **Live Microphone Streaming** | ✅ | ✅ |
| **Transcription** | ✅ | ✅ |
| **Speaker Diarization** | ✅ | ✅ |
| **Translation** | ✅ | ✅ |
| **Topic Detection** | ✅ | ✅ |
| **Summarization** | ✅ | ✅ |
| **Virtual Meeting Rooms (Whereby)** | ❌ | ✅ |
| **Browse Transcripts Page** | ❌ | ✅ |
| **Search Functionality** | ❌ | ✅ |
| **Persistent Storage** | ❌ | ✅ |
## Architecture Overview
Reflector consists of three main components:
- **Frontend**: React application built with Next.js 14
- **Backend**: Python server using FastAPI
- **Processing**: Scalable GPU workers for ML inference (Modal.com or local)

# File Processing Pipeline
The file processing pipeline handles uploaded audio files, optimizing for accuracy and throughput.
## Pipeline Stages
### 1. Input Stage
**Accepted Formats:**
- MP3 (most common)
- WAV (uncompressed)
- M4A (Apple format)
- WebM (browser recordings)
- MP4 (video with audio track)
**File Validation:**
- Maximum size: 2GB (configurable)
- Minimum duration: 5 seconds
- Maximum duration: 6 hours
- Sample rate: Any (will be resampled)
### 2. Pre-processing
**Audio Normalization:**
```python
# Convert to standard format
- Sample rate: 16kHz (Whisper requirement)
- Channels: Mono
- Bit depth: 16-bit
- Format: WAV
```
**Volume Normalization:**
- Target: -23 LUFS (broadcast standard)
- Prevents clipping
- Improves transcription accuracy
**Noise Reduction (Optional):**
- Background noise removal
- Echo cancellation
- High-pass filter for rumble
### 3. Chunking Strategy
**Default Configuration:**
```yaml
chunk_size: 30 # seconds
overlap: 1 # seconds
max_parallel: 10
silence_detection: true
```
**Chunking with Silence Detection:**
- Detects silence periods
- Attempts to break at natural pauses
- Maintains context with overlap
- Preserves sentence boundaries
**Chunk Metadata:**
```json
{
"chunk_id": "chunk_001",
"start_time": 0.0,
"end_time": 30.0,
"duration": 30.0,
"has_speech": true,
"audio_hash": "sha256:..."
}
```
### 4. Transcription Processing
**Whisper Models:**
| Model | Size | Speed | Accuracy | Use Case |
|-------|------|-------|----------|----------|
| tiny | 39M | Very Fast | 85% | Quick drafts |
| base | 74M | Fast | 89% | Good balance |
| small | 244M | Medium | 91% | Better accuracy |
| medium | 769M | Slow | 93% | High quality |
| large-v3 | 1550M | Very Slow | 96% | Best quality |
**Processing Configuration:**
```python
transcription_config = {
"model": "whisper-base",
"language": "auto", # or specify: "en", "es", etc.
"task": "transcribe", # or "translate"
"temperature": 0, # deterministic
"compression_ratio_threshold": 2.4,
"no_speech_threshold": 0.6,
"condition_on_previous_text": True,
"initial_prompt": None, # optional context
}
```
**Parallel Processing:**
- Each chunk processed independently
- GPU batching for efficiency
- Automatic load balancing
- Failure isolation
### 5. Diarization (Speaker Identification)
**Pyannote 3.1 Pipeline:**
1. **Voice Activity Detection (VAD)**
- Identifies speech segments
- Filters out silence and noise
- Precision: 95%+
2. **Speaker Embedding**
- Extracts voice characteristics
- 256-dimensional vectors
- Speaker-invariant features
3. **Clustering**
- Groups similar voice embeddings
- Agglomerative clustering
- Automatic speaker count detection
4. **Segmentation**
- Assigns speaker labels to time segments
- Handles overlapping speech
- Minimum segment duration: 0.5s
**Configuration:**
```python
diarization_config = {
"min_speakers": 1,
"max_speakers": 10,
"min_duration": 0.5,
"clustering": "AgglomerativeClustering",
"embedding_model": "speechbrain/spkrec-ecapa-voxceleb",
}
```
### 6. Alignment & Merging
**Chunk Assembly:**
```python
# Merge overlapping segments
for chunk in chunks:
# Remove overlap duplicates
if chunk.start < previous.end:
chunk.text = resolve_overlap(previous, chunk)
# Maintain timeline
merged_transcript.append(chunk)
```
**Speaker Alignment:**
- Map diarization timeline to transcript
- Resolve speaker changes mid-sentence
- Handle multiple speakers per segment
**Quality Checks:**
- Timeline consistency
- No gaps in transcript
- Speaker label continuity
- Confidence score validation
### 7. Post-processing Chain
**Text Formatting:**
- Sentence capitalization
- Punctuation restoration
- Number formatting
- Acronym detection
**Translation (Optional):**
```python
translation_config = {
"model": "facebook/seamless-m4t-medium",
"source_lang": "auto",
"target_langs": ["es", "fr", "de"],
"preserve_formatting": True
}
```
**Topic Detection:**
- LLM-based analysis
- Extract 3-5 key topics
- Keyword extraction
- Entity recognition
**Summarization:**
```python
summary_config = {
"model": "openai-compatible",
"max_length": 500,
"style": "bullets", # or "paragraph"
"include_action_items": True,
"include_decisions": True
}
```
### 8. Storage & Delivery
**Database Storage:**
```sql
-- Main transcript record
INSERT INTO transcripts (
id, title, duration, language,
transcript_text, transcript_json,
speakers, topics, summary,
created_at, processing_time
) VALUES (...);
-- Processing metadata
INSERT INTO processing_metadata (
transcript_id, model_versions,
chunk_count, total_chunks,
error_count, warnings
) VALUES (...);
```
**File Storage:**
- Original audio: S3 (optional)
- Processed chunks: Temporary (24h)
- Transcript exports: JSON, SRT, VTT, TXT
**Notification:**
```json
{
"type": "webhook",
"url": "https://your-app.com/webhook",
"payload": {
"transcript_id": "...",
"status": "completed",
"duration": 3600,
"processing_time": 180
}
}
```
## Processing Times
**Estimated times for 1 hour of audio:**
| Component | Fast Mode | Balanced | High Quality |
|-----------|-----------|----------|--------------|
| Pre-processing | 10s | 10s | 10s |
| Transcription | 60s | 180s | 600s |
| Diarization | 30s | 60s | 120s |
| Post-processing | 20s | 30s | 60s |
| **Total** | **2 min** | **5 min** | **13 min** |
## Error Handling
### Retry Strategy
```python
@celery.task(
bind=True,
max_retries=3,
default_retry_delay=60,
retry_backoff=True
)
def process_chunk(self, chunk_id):
try:
# Process chunk
result = transcribe(chunk_id)
except Exception as exc:
# Exponential backoff
raise self.retry(exc=exc)
```
### Partial Recovery
- Continue with successful chunks
- Mark failed chunks in output
- Provide partial transcript
- Report processing issues
### Fallback Options
1. **Model Fallback:**
- If large model fails, try medium
- If GPU fails, try CPU
- If Modal fails, try local
2. **Quality Degradation:**
- Reduce chunk size
- Disable post-processing
- Skip diarization if needed
## Optimization Tips
### For Speed
1. Use smaller models (tiny/base)
2. Increase parallel chunks
3. Disable diarization
4. Skip post-processing
5. Use GPU acceleration
### For Accuracy
1. Use larger models (medium/large)
2. Enable all pre-processing
3. Reduce chunk size
4. Enable silence detection
5. Multiple pass processing
### For Cost
1. Use Modal spot instances
2. Batch multiple files
3. Cache common phrases
4. Optimize chunk size
5. Selective post-processing
## Monitoring
### Metrics to Track
```python
metrics = {
"processing_time": histogram,
"chunk_success_rate": gauge,
"model_accuracy": histogram,
"queue_depth": gauge,
"gpu_utilization": gauge,
"cost_per_hour": counter
}
```
### Quality Metrics
- Word Error Rate (WER)
- Diarization Error Rate (DER)
- Confidence scores
- Processing speed
- User feedback
### Alerts
- Processing time > 30 minutes
- Error rate > 5%
- Queue depth > 100
- GPU memory > 90%
- Cost spike detected

# API Reference
The Reflector API provides a comprehensive RESTful interface for audio transcription, meeting management, and real-time streaming capabilities.
## Base URL
```
http://localhost:8000/v1
```
All API endpoints are prefixed with `/v1/` for versioning.
## Authentication
Reflector supports multiple authentication modes:
- **No Authentication** (Public Mode): Basic transcription and upload functionality
- **JWT Authentication** (Private Mode): Full feature access including meeting rooms and persistent storage
- **OAuth/OIDC via Authentik**: Enterprise single sign-on integration
## Core Endpoints
### Transcripts
Manage audio transcriptions and their associated metadata.
#### List Transcripts
```http
GET /v1/transcripts/
```
Returns a paginated list of transcripts with filtering options.
#### Create Transcript
```http
POST /v1/transcripts/
```
Create a new transcript from uploaded audio or initialize for streaming.
#### Get Transcript
```http
GET /v1/transcripts/{transcript_id}
```
Retrieve detailed information about a specific transcript.
#### Update Transcript
```http
PATCH /v1/transcripts/{transcript_id}
```
Update transcript metadata, summary, or processing status.
#### Delete Transcript
```http
DELETE /v1/transcripts/{transcript_id}
```
Remove a transcript and its associated data.
### Audio Processing
#### Upload Audio
```http
POST /v1/transcripts_audio/{transcript_id}/upload
```
Upload an audio file for transcription processing.
**Supported formats:**
- WAV, MP3, M4A, FLAC, OGG
- Maximum file size: 500MB
- Sample rates: 8kHz - 48kHz
#### Download Audio
```http
GET /v1/transcripts_audio/{transcript_id}/download
```
Download the original or processed audio file.
#### Stream Audio
```http
GET /v1/transcripts_audio/{transcript_id}/stream
```
Stream audio content with range support for progressive playback.
### WebRTC Streaming
Real-time audio streaming via WebRTC for live transcription.
#### Initialize WebRTC Session
```http
POST /v1/transcripts_webrtc/{transcript_id}/offer
```
Create a WebRTC offer for establishing a peer connection.
#### Complete WebRTC Handshake
```http
POST /v1/transcripts_webrtc/{transcript_id}/answer
```
Submit the WebRTC answer to complete connection setup.
### WebSocket Streaming
Real-time updates and live transcription via WebSocket.
#### WebSocket Endpoint
```ws
ws://localhost:8000/v1/transcripts_websocket/{transcript_id}
```
Receive real-time transcription updates, speaker changes, and processing status.
**Message Types:**
- `transcription`: New transcribed text segments
- `diarization`: Speaker identification updates
- `status`: Processing status changes
- `error`: Error notifications
### Meetings
Manage virtual meeting rooms and recordings.
#### List Meetings
```http
GET /v1/meetings/
```
Get all meetings for the authenticated user.
#### Create Meeting
```http
POST /v1/meetings/
```
Initialize a new meeting room with Whereby integration.
#### Join Meeting
```http
POST /v1/meetings/{meeting_id}/join
```
Join an existing meeting and start recording.
#### End Meeting
```http
POST /v1/meetings/{meeting_id}/end
```
End the meeting and finalize the recording.
### Rooms
Virtual meeting room configuration and management.
#### List Rooms
```http
GET /v1/rooms/
```
Get available meeting rooms.
#### Create Room
```http
POST /v1/rooms/
```
Create a new persistent meeting room.
#### Update Room Settings
```http
PATCH /v1/rooms/{room_id}
```
Modify room configuration and permissions.
## Response Formats
### Success Response
```json
{
"id": "uuid",
"created_at": "2025-01-20T10:00:00Z",
"updated_at": "2025-01-20T10:30:00Z",
"data": {...}
}
```
### Error Response
```json
{
"error": {
"code": "ERROR_CODE",
"message": "Human-readable error message",
"details": {...}
}
}
```
### Status Codes
- `200 OK`: Successful request
- `201 Created`: Resource created successfully
- `204 No Content`: Successful deletion
- `400 Bad Request`: Invalid request parameters
- `401 Unauthorized`: Authentication required
- `403 Forbidden`: Insufficient permissions
- `404 Not Found`: Resource not found
- `409 Conflict`: Resource conflict
- `422 Unprocessable Entity`: Validation error
- `429 Too Many Requests`: Rate limit exceeded
- `500 Internal Server Error`: Server error
## Rate Limiting
- **Anonymous users**: 100 requests per minute
- **Authenticated users**: 1000 requests per minute
- **WebSocket connections**: 10 concurrent per user
- **File uploads**: 10 per hour for anonymous, 100 per hour for authenticated
## WebSocket Protocol
The WebSocket connection provides real-time updates during transcription processing. The server sends structured messages to communicate different events and data updates.
### Connection
```javascript
const ws = new WebSocket('ws://localhost:8000/v1/transcripts_websocket/{transcript_id}');
```
### Message Types and Formats
#### Transcription Update
Sent when new text is transcribed from the audio stream.
```json
{
"type": "transcription",
"data": {
"text": "The transcribed text segment",
"speaker": "Speaker 1",
"timestamp": 1705745623.456,
"confidence": 0.95,
"segment_id": "seg_001",
"is_final": true
}
}
```
#### Diarization Update
Sent when speaker changes are detected or speaker labels are updated.
```json
{
"type": "diarization",
"data": {
"speaker": "Speaker 2",
"speaker_id": "spk_002",
"start_time": 1705745620.123,
"end_time": 1705745625.456,
"confidence": 0.87
}
}
```
#### Processing Status
Sent to indicate changes in the processing pipeline status.
```json
{
"type": "status",
"data": {
"status": "processing",
"stage": "transcription",
"progress": 45.5,
"message": "Processing audio chunk 12 of 26"
}
}
```
Status values:
- `initializing`: Setting up processing pipeline
- `processing`: Active transcription/diarization
- `completed`: Processing finished successfully
- `failed`: Processing encountered an error
- `paused`: Processing temporarily suspended
#### Summary Update
Sent when AI-generated summaries or topics are available.
```json
{
"type": "summary",
"data": {
"summary": "Brief summary of the conversation",
"topics": ["topic1", "topic2", "topic3"],
"action_items": ["action 1", "action 2"],
"key_points": ["point 1", "point 2"]
}
}
```
#### Error Messages
Sent when errors occur during processing.
```json
{
"type": "error",
"data": {
"code": "AUDIO_FORMAT_ERROR",
"message": "Unsupported audio format",
"details": {
"format": "unknown",
"sample_rate": 0
},
"recoverable": false
}
}
```
#### Heartbeat/Keepalive
Sent periodically to maintain the connection.
```json
{
"type": "ping",
"data": {
"timestamp": 1705745630.000
}
}
```
### Client-to-Server Messages
Clients can send control messages to the server:
#### Start/Resume Processing
```json
{
"action": "start",
"params": {}
}
```
#### Pause Processing
```json
{
"action": "pause",
"params": {}
}
```
#### Request Status
```json
{
"action": "get_status",
"params": {}
}
```
## OpenAPI Specification
The complete OpenAPI 3.0 specification is available at:
```
http://localhost:8000/v1/openapi.json
```
You can import this specification into tools like:
- Postman
- Insomnia
- Swagger UI
- OpenAPI Generator (for client SDK generation)
## SDK Support
While Reflector doesn't provide official SDKs, you can generate client libraries using the OpenAPI specification with tools like:
- **Python**: `openapi-python-client`
- **TypeScript**: `openapi-typescript-codegen`
- **Go**: `oapi-codegen`
- **Java**: `openapi-generator`
## Example Usage
### Python Example
```python
import requests
# Upload and transcribe audio
with open('meeting.mp3', 'rb') as f:
response = requests.post(
'http://localhost:8000/v1/transcripts/',
files={'file': f}
)
transcript_id = response.json()['id']
# Check transcription status
status = requests.get(
f'http://localhost:8000/v1/transcripts/{transcript_id}'
).json()
print(f"Transcription status: {status['status']}")
```
### JavaScript WebSocket Example
```javascript
// Connect to WebSocket for real-time transcription updates
const ws = new WebSocket(`ws://localhost:8000/v1/transcripts_websocket/${transcriptId}`);
ws.onopen = () => {
console.log('Connected to transcription WebSocket');
};
ws.onmessage = (event) => {
const message = JSON.parse(event.data);
switch(message.type) {
case 'transcription':
console.log(`[${message.data.speaker}]: ${message.data.text}`);
break;
case 'diarization':
console.log(`Speaker change: ${message.data.speaker}`);
break;
case 'status':
console.log(`Status: ${message.data.status}`);
break;
case 'error':
console.error(`Error: ${message.data.message}`);
break;
}
};
ws.onerror = (error) => {
console.error('WebSocket error:', error);
};
ws.onclose = () => {
console.log('WebSocket connection closed');
};
```
